Thank You: hot brown open faced sandwich

Misc.
ADVERTISEMENT
thanks a million for your repley. as a child growing up in bowling green, ky., i remember a slice of country ham on this wonderful sandwich and the sauce possibly containing a hint of worcestershire and maybe cayenne. any thoughts?
